Sophie de Seigneux completed her medical studies in Geneva, earning her medical degree in 2001 and her doctorate in 2004, followed by a specialisation in Internal Medicine (FMH, 2004). From 2004 to 2008, she pursued research in renal pathophysiology in Aarhus, Denmark, where she obtained a PhD. She then specialised in Nephrology in Geneva and Paris, obtaining her FMH qualification in 2009.

Since 2009, she has combined clinical practice with fundamental research, initially as a clinical research fellow (cheffe de clinique scientifique), and later as an Ambizione Fellow of the Swiss National Science Foundation (SNSF). She was also part of the Swiss National Centre of Competence in Research in Nephrology (NCCR Kidney.ch).

Her research focuses on the pathophysiology and management of chronic kidney disease — a common and debilitating condition — and its complications. More specifically, she investigates the role of tubular cells as potential therapeutic targets, as well as the development of non-invasive diagnostic and monitoring tools for kidney disease.

She was appointed Privat-docent at the Faculty of Medicine and Médecin adjointe agrégée in the Division of Nephrology at Geneva 玉美人传媒 Hospitals (HUG) in 2014. That same year, she was awarded an SNSF Professorship grant. In October 2015, she was appointed Assistant Professor in the Department of Internal Medicine at the Faculty of Medicine of the 玉美人传媒. In 2021, she was promoted to Full Professor and Head of the Division of Nephrology and Hypertension.

The Board of Directors of Geneva 玉美人传媒 Hospitals (HUG) has appointed Professor Sophie de Seigneux as Head of the Department of Medicine, effective 1 January 2025.
